Utility-scale solar, wind, and battery storage will add more than 80 gigawatts (GW) of new generating capacity in the US by February 28, 2027, while total fossil fuel and nuclear power capacity will fall by almost 5 GW, according to data just released by the US Energy Information Administration (EIA), which was reviewed by the SUN DAY Campaign.
